A conversation about the controversial Constitutional Handgun Carry Bill in Texas and Eminent Domain as it relates to Bruce's Beach in Manhattan Beach, California, and the County of Los Angeles.
Bruce's Beach was a resort that was owned by and operated by and for members of the 'black' community. It provided the 'black' community with opportunities unavailable at other beach areas because of segregation.
The property was acquired via eminent domain proceedings in the 1920s and closed down. Chief Duane Yellowfeather Shepard is the official spokesman and a descendant of the Bruce family as a member of an indigenous tribe.
